Summary

A washed coffee from Rwanda, produced by the Abateraninkunga Ba Sholi cooperative in the Sholi Cell, Cyeza, Muhanga region. The cooperative, founded in 2008 by 30 women, now has 670 members. This Bourbon variety coffee is grown at 1800-2000 meters above sea level and offers a soft, silky mouthfeel with pleasant acidity. Flavour notes include lingonberry, red apple, black tea, and dark caramel.
